Essential Ingredients

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• Boneless, Skinless Chicken Breasts: Use about 3-4 chicken breasts, adjusting based on how many guests you have.
  • Fresh Garlic: Choose firm garlic cloves for maximum flavor; trust me, no one likes mushy garlic.
  • Greek Yogurt: It gives creaminess without the extra calories of mayonnaise; plus, who doesn’t love a healthy twist?
  • Celery Stalks: Crisp and crunchy, they add a delightful texture to each slider.
  • Red Grapes: These add sweetness and color—because who doesn’t want their food to look pretty?
  • Chopped Walnuts: For that perfect nutty crunch; just be careful not to overdo it unless you want them stealing the show.
  • Slider Buns: Look for fresh ones; they should be soft yet sturdy enough to hold all that delicious filling.

Let’s Make it together

The Chicken Prep: Start by poaching the chicken breasts in simmering water seasoned with salt until cooked through—about 15-20 minutes will do. Set aside to cool slightly before shredding.

The Flavorful Mix: In a large mixing bowl, combine shredded chicken with diced celery, chopped walnuts, red grapes halved, and minced garlic. flavorful shrimp pasta The colors will brighten up your day!

The Creamy Dressing: Add Greek yogurt along with salt and pepper to taste. Mix everything thoroughly until well combined; your kitchen should smell heavenly at this stage.

Assemble Your Sliders: Cut slider buns in half and generously spoon the chicken salad mixture onto each bottom half. Top with the bun tops and watch those glorious creations come together.

The Grand Finale!: Serve immediately or cover and refrigerate for up to an hour before serving—if you can resist! Garnish with fresh herbs if desired for an extra pop of color.
